When Cai moved into a new house, he planted two trees in his backyard. At the time of planting, Tree A was 20 inches tall and Tree B was 38 inches tall. Each year thereafter, Tree A grew by 6 inches per year and Tree B grew by 3 inches per year. Let A represent the height of Tree A t years after being planted and let B represent the height of Tree B t years after being planted. Write an equation for each situation, in terms of, t, and determine the interval of time, , t, when Tree A is taller than Tree B.

The equation for the height of Tree A, A, t years after being planted is:

A = 20 + 6t

The equation for the height of Tree B, B, t years after being planted is:

B = 38 + 3t

To determine the interval of time when Tree A is taller than Tree B, we can set A greater than B and solve for t:

A > B

20 + 6t > 38 + 3t

Subtracting 3t from both sides:

20 + 3t > 38

Subtracting 20 from both sides:

3t > 18

Dividing both sides by 3:

t > 6

Therefore, Tree A is taller than Tree B when t is greater than 6 years.
